Description

Description:

***: To be fully engaged in providing Quality / No Harm, Customer Experience, and Stewardship by: working as a team to maintain responsible attitudes, performing laboratory testing to provide quality results and using resources efficiently.

  • Performs high complexity testing under direct supervision unless the technician meets the minimum qualification set forth by the state and CLIA regulations.
  • This employee meets the minimum qualifications set forth by the state and CLIA regulations.
  • This Medical Technician is assigned to one or more of the following laboratory sections of responsibility: Blood Bank, Microbiology ( Bacteriology Virology Parasitology Mycology Mycobacteriology Immunology Molecular Diagnostics), Core Lab ( Hematology Coagulation Routine Chemistry Urinalysis), Special Chemistry.

Qualifications:


QUALIFICATIONS REQUIRED:


  • As required for Medical Technician licensure by State of Florida and in accordance with CLIA guidelines.
  • Appropriate certification by the ASCP or other similar accrediting agencies preferred.
  • Must be willing and able to work with biohazardous/toxic materials following OSHA guidelines.
  • Excellent human relations skills
  • Excellent organizational skills.
  • Excellent communication skills.
  • Strong computer skills.
  • Knowledge of quality assurance and quality control procedures.
  • Must be able to work weekends when needed.
  • May be required to take call

PHYSICAL DEMANDS:


  • Visual acuity and manual dexterity to perform clinical/technical tasks.
  • Must pass color blindness test.
  • Must be able to lift 1020 lbs unassisted.
  • Must be able to stand for extended periods (23 hours)
  • Must be able to sit and operate a computer.

MENTAL DEMANDS:


  • Must be able to function in a highly stressful environment.
  • Responsible for problem solving situations.
  • Able to make independent decisions.
  • Competent and confident in interpretation of all tests, authorized by the medical director and for which training and competencies are documented, performed in the section.
